Solution for 418 is what percent of 436:

418:436*100 =

(418*100):436 =

41800:436 = 95.87

Now we have: 418 is what percent of 436 = 95.87

Question: 418 is what percent of 436?

Percentage solution with steps:

Step 1: We make the assumption that 436 is 100% since it is our output value.

Step 2: We next represent the value we seek with {x}.

Step 3: From step 1, it follows that {100\%}={436}.

Step 4: In the same vein, {x\%}={418}.

Step 5: This gives us a pair of simple equations:

{100\%}={436}(1).

{x\%}={418}(2).

Step 6: By simply dividing equation 1 by equation 2 and taking note of the fact that both the LHS
(left hand side) of both equations have the same unit (%); we have

\frac{100\%}{x\%}=\frac{436}{418}

Step 7: Taking the inverse (or reciprocal) of both sides yields

\frac{x\%}{100\%}=\frac{418}{436}

\Rightarrow{x} = {95.87\%}

Therefore, {418} is {95.87\%} of {436}.
